Summary

The liquefied natural gas (LNG) market has faced significant volatility in recent years, driven by fluctuating supply and demand dynamics, geopolitical influences, and shifting energy policies. This volatility posed multiple challenges for LNG buyers with many staying on the sidelines during periods of extreme prices. However, for those able to freely control their shipping logistics by having
their own fleet and through sales & purchase agreement (SPA) destination flexibility clauses, price volatility provides opportunities which they can capitalise and extract significant value from.
